Midden in Inis Gé Theas

Midden

What is recorded here

Eroding out of the SW slope of a possible habitation site/sand-hill (MA023-032001-) on the SE shoreline of Inishkea South. A thin layer (L c. 0.6m; D 0.02-0.05m) of limpet and periwinkle shells is visible in section in the sandy body of the mound. A loose surface scatter of shell which has eroded out of the layer spreads downslope. A habitation site (MA023-033001-) and another midden (MA023-033002-) are located c. 30m to N.
